Teletica installs Chyron Channel Box

Nov 18, 2008 9:46 AM


             

Costa Rican TV broadcaster Teletica has installed Chyron’s Channel Box software channel-branding system to complement an existing tandem of HyperX2 graphics systems.

According to Teletica technical manager Alexander Porras, HyperX2’s combined SD/HD switching capabilities, real-time response and tool sets are central to its on-air look. The Channel Box data-binding features meet the broadcaster’s branding needs, he added.

Running on version 2.0 software, Teletica’s Channel Box features advanced data-binding technology along with a self-adjusting content awareness feature that makes automated promo generation simple and efficient.
